Output 7ea421cb5a705996eb6e00021a064a5929e198b01d678ef5d06ea3d933c78290:1

value
134233923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 126eb260d0e32bb0929fa0a56adcf92e145f20c6 OP_EQUAL
address
33NUhLw8hZqgPbzdohWNKtU94huVEUX6UJ
transaction
7ea421cb5a705996eb6e00021a064a5929e198b01d678ef5d06ea3d933c78290
spent
true